Is the rookie wall still that prevalent? I feel like since the NCAA increased the number of regular season games to 12, now teams are regularly playing 13 with a championship game, those teams given a bowl game makes it 14 and those in the championship series increasing to as many as 16 for the championship teams. That as well as increased training programs at almost all levels of college play have college athletes coming in almost better shape than many veterans. Schwesinger who has always played with a high motor probably won't see it as much as Graham who's energy is spent in spurts. I would have worried more about Judkins if he came in and became a workhorse after spending his last year at tOSU on a RBC system. Regardless, it's going to be exciting for the opening to the season.

Video proof makes the truth in this case easy to find. I won't speak to her motivation because I have no way of knowing that. She could have just been mad and was being vindictive for all I know. As has been mentioned already, the NFL is a conglomerate entity of 32 corporations. They have a public image to protect. We've seen many times where groups from all sides have boycotted and the press has given a lot of bad coverage based on how a corporation handles many social issues. One such issue, not nearly the least of which is how thy handle the abuse of women.
No corporation wants all of that negative attention. It simply isn't good for business. So no matter how clear cut a case may or may not be, they have to give it the time and consideration people expect. They can't simply rush things to give it the appearance they didn't do their due diligence. That's what's going on here.
